The Nasdaq-listed firm CEA Industries, Inc. showcased over 30% annualized gains through its Bitcoin treasury strategy. This move aligns with rising institutional interest in digital assets, reflecting a broader market shift towards cryptocurrency investments.
CEA Industries, led by CEO David Namdar, has taken proactive steps by realigning its operations toward digital asset treasuries. The firm announced a $500 million placement as part of its strategy to accrue Bitcoin, positioning itself alongside major players.

As David Namdar, CEO of CEA Industries, stated, “We’re at the beginning of a $100–200 billion shift of capital into digital asset treasuries. BNB is positioned to be a winner in this wave, and BNC’s role is to lead institutional investors into that ecosystem with transparency, discipline, and scale.”
